2009 BMW 535 vs. 2008 Lexus GX
To start off, 2009 BMW 535 is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2008 Lexus GX.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2008 Lexus GX would be higher. At 4,670 cc (8 cylinders), 2008 Lexus GX is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 BMW 535 (300 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 37 more horse power than 2008 Lexus GX. (263 HP @ 5400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 BMW 535 should accelerate faster than 2008 Lexus GX.
Because 2008 Lexus GX is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2009 BMW 535.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Lexus GX will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Lexus GX (438 Nm @ 3400 RPM) has 31 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 BMW 535. (407 Nm @ 1400 RPM). This means 2008 Lexus GX will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 BMW 535. 2008 Lexus GX has automatic transmission and 2009 BMW 535 has manual transmission. 2009 BMW 535 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2008 Lexus GX will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
